  • Marriott International is a leading global lodging company based in Bethesda, Maryland, USA, with more than 4,100 properties in 79 countries and reported revenues of nearly $14 billion in fiscal year 2014. Its heritage can be traced to a root beer stand opened in Washington, D.C., in 1927 by J. Willard and Alice S. Marriott. The company operates and fran...

    Executive Sous Chef

    Job Summary

    • Exhibits culinary talents by personally performing tasks while assisting in leading the staff and managing all food related functions. Works to continually improve guest and employee satisfaction while maximizing the financial performance in all areas of responsibility. Assists in supervising all kitchen areas to ensure a consistent, high quality product is produced. Responsible for guiding and developing staff including direct reports. Must ensure sanitation and food standards are achieved. Areas of responsibility comprise overseeing all food preparation areas (e.g., banquets, room service, restaurants, bar/lounge and employee cafeteria) and all support areas (e.g., dish room and purchasing) as applicable.

    Job Summary

    • The Marketing and Communications Manager is part of an important team that creates and executes property-level communications to our customers. Under the leadership of the Director of Marketing and Communication, this role promotes on-brand messaging to customers through traditional, digital, and social media channels all with the goal of enhancing the image of the hotel. This role helps build direct marketing plans, targeted campaigns, and activated channels to the end of driving consumer awareness and preference, increasing market share, and building broader portfolio and brand awareness. This role focuses on showcasing Food and Beverage promotions, both to hotel guests and to local patrons. As part of the Marketing and Communication team, this role is fully connected into resources in their region; Marketing and Communication Managers liaise and build deep partnerships with their regional eCommerce and Marketing teams to verify all local, social, and digital marketing efforts are effectively integrated with the selling efforts for the organization. This role also gets to do a little bit of everything, from balancing traditional and digital marketing and eCommerce activities to contributing to public relations (PR) activities for the hotel. Success is measured by how well they help drive the sales and revenue strategy of the property, social media engagement and also by how effectively leveraged the resources around them are to create truly compelling marketing and communications campaigns.
